Effect of operational conditions on the rate of citric acid production by rotating disk contactor using Aspergillus niger

Abstract:The effect of operational conditions such as the specific biofilm area, oxygen concentration, and rotation speed on citric acid production by a rotating disk contactor (RDC) was examined. The overall productivity for a repeated batch culture was also compared with that for a non-repeated batch culture. The citric acid production rate per unit biofilm area (P) was almost constant regardless of the value of the specific film area. The rotation speed of the disks had no effect on P in the range of 5–20 rpm. The apparent saturation constant of dissolved oxygen concentration was 2.05 mg/l. Overall citric acid productivity for a 3-times-repeated batch culture was 1.7 times higher than that for the non-repeated batch culture.
